Description

Site work for a water / sewer project in Cleveland, Ohio. Completed plans call for site work for a water / sewer project. In general, the work shall consist of furnishing all labor, materials, equipment, and incidentals for construction of the following work: Demolishing and removing existing concrete around the basin perimeter and removing the existing basin impoundment Dredging and disposing of existing sediments and regrading the basin Removing existing pipe segments and reinstalling new inlets and outlets Restoring the site.
